Lattice study of monopoles in the Electroweak theory
Abstract
We investigated numerically properties of Nambu monopoles in lattice Electroweak theory at realistic values of α and θW. Our choice of parameters of lattice Lagrangian corresponds to large values of the Higgs boson mass MH > 2 MW. We find that the density of Nambu monopoles cannot be predicted by the choice of the initial parameters of Electroweak theory and should be considered as the new external parameter of the theory. We also investigate the difference between the versions of Electroweak theory with the gauge groups SU(2) U(1) and SU(2) U(1)/Z2. We do not detect any difference at α 1/128. However, such a difference appears in the strong coupling region and is related to the properties of monopoles constructed of the hypercharge field.
